Fourth, the processing speed is high (Velocity). This is the most significant feature of the big data era, unlike the era of
small data and the era of probability and statistics. In traditional economic censuses, censuses and other areas, data can be
tolerated for days or even a year, as the data obtained at this time still makes sense. Moreover, due to technical
limitations, the collected data has been lagging behind, and the structure of statistical analysis is lagging behind, but it
must be accepted. Data generation and collection is very fast, and the amount of data is growing all the time. With
advanced technology, people can collect data in real time. But in most cases, if you don’t process the data in time, the
advanced collection and sorting methods will be meaningless and you won’t need big data. For example, IBM proposed the
concept of “big data-level stream computing,” which is designed for real-time analysis of data and results to increase
practical value. Therefore, timely and fast processing of data and results is the most important feature of big data.

E-Commerce Concept
E-commerce generally refers to Internet technology, based on browser/server applications, through the Internet platform,
buyers and sellers through various trade activities to achieve consumer online shopping, online payment and new business
activities of various business activities and other models. The expansion history of e-commerce has a close relationship
with the progress of computer network technology. E-commerce includes many models, such as B2B (Ning et al., 2018)
(Business to Business), B2C (Business to Consumer), C2C (Consumer to Consumer), and O2O (Online to Offline). The main
centralized e-commerce model is shown in Figure 2.
